Properties of the Na3VO4-HCl-H2O system in the dependence on acidity and concentration of the sodium vanadate solution

Description

Concentration of free hydrogen ions and the composition of sediments emerging in the Na3VO4 solution by addition of Sm3+ ions were studied as influenced by acidity and concentration of the solution. The system was studied at five constant concentrations of vanadium (0.08, 0.12, 0.175, 0.22 and 0.32 g.ion/l) at different pH. Samarium vanadate was precipitated from the Na3VO4-HCl-H2O equilibrium system by equimolecular solutions of Sm(NO3)3 in the ratio 1:1. In the alkaline region the processes of protonization and dimerization in diluted sodium vanadate solutions were simultaneous. In more concentrated solutions these processes were separated, since the increase in V concentration promoted protonization rather than dimerization, especially in aklakine solutions
